Author: Gillmore, Parker ("Ubique"):
Title: Leaves From a Sportsman's Diary.
Published: London: Gibbings & Company Ltd., 1896.
Classification: Catalogue 05a - Country sports
Description: Second edition. vii, 341 pp + 1 pp ads. Frontispiece - portrait of Gillmore. A volume aimed at the largely increasing class of "Sportsmen Naturalists". A collection of 53 sporting anecdotes including: Bears and Beavers, Ferocity of Eagles, Spingbok, Dog Breaking, Weight of Elephants' Tusks, Gun-Shy Dogs, Wildfowl Shooting in the Western States, Lake Parmachini , Newfoundland Dog, Snipe Shooting, Canada Goose, Giraffe Hunting, American Bears Rifles, Bullets etc. etc. Some light foxing on eps and title only. Text clean. Previous owner's inscription on ffep. Green cloth boards with gilt lettering on spine. Vignette of salmon on front board and elephant on spine. Top and bottom of spine lightly bumped. Corners very lightly rubbed. Overall condition VG. No dust wrapper.
